The Meaning and Etymology of Smit The name 'Smit' is deeply rooted in the Germanic languages, meaning "blacksmith." This isn’t just any occupation—it’s one of the oldest and most revered trades in human history. The word derives from the Old High German 'smitan,' meaning "to smite or strike," which perfectly captures the blacksmith’s art of forging metal with hammer strikes. The Origin Story Tracing 'Smit' back, we find it closely related to surnames like 'Smith,' 'Schmidt,' and 'Smyth,' which are among the most common surnames in the English-speaking and Germanic worlds. Originally occupational surnames, these names have transitioned into first names more recently, carrying their powerful meanings into new personal identities.
